A prospective randomised comparison of I-gel and LMA-unique Supraglottic Airway Devices for use during Clinical Anaesthesia

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. ASA I or II patients (fit and healthy or with minor well-controlled chronic disease) 2. Age 16-70 years 3. Weight 30-120 kg 4. Not pregnant 5. Booked for elective surgery of duration <2 hours 6. Fasted 7. Normal airway assessment 8. Consenting

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Age 80, or weight 120kg 2. Pregnancy 3. Emergency surgery 4. Surgery > 2 hours duration 5. Patient not fit (ASA >=III) 6. Patient not starved 7. History of symptomatic reflux disease 8. History of difficult airway mgmt during previous anaesthesia 9. Anticipated difficult airway 10. Previous radiotherapy to head/neck 11. Heavy smokers >20 cigarettes/d 12. Non-consenting

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Clinically successful placement of the device, ie 'successful insertion' and 'adequate leak pressure'.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Incidence of complications and post-operative presence of any subjective difficulty or pain with speaking, swallowing, jaw or neck movement, or any alteration to hearing or tongue sensation.
